Compare commits

...

4 Commits

Author SHA1 Message Date
agent-company b74e9de04d feat: implement tablet 2-column grid layout for issue and PR lists
Add grid layout at >= 640px breakpoint for #issue-list and #pull-list
containers, matching the existing .card-grid tablet behavior. Cards
render in a 2-column grid on tablet while maintaining single-column
on mobile.

Closes leeworks-agents/gitea-mobile#105

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-03-28 06:06:24 +00:00
AI-Manager 5c54d587aa Merge pull request 'feat: add review status and merge indicator to PR list' (#102) from feature/pr-status-icons-97 into master
Build and Push / test (push) Has been cancelled
Build and Push / build (push) Has been cancelled
2026-03-28 05:03:26 +00:00
AI-Manager c9e883da87 Merge pull request 'feat: display assignee avatar in issue list rows' (#101) from feature/assignee-avatar-98 into master
Build and Push / test (push) Has been cancelled
Build and Push / build (push) Has been cancelled
2026-03-28 05:03:13 +00:00
agent-company 047e90cd76 feat: display assignee avatar in issue list rows
Replace plain-text assignee login with a circular avatar image using
the existing .avatar CSS class. Includes title attribute for
accessibility. Unassigned issues show no avatar.

Closes leeworks-agents/gitea-mobile#98

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-03-28 03:06:00 +00:00
2 changed files with 7 additions and 3 deletions
+1 -1
View File
@@ -8,7 +8,7 @@
<span class="label" style="color:#{{.Color}};border:1px solid #{{.Color}}">{{.Name}}</span>
{{end}}
{{if .Assignee}}
<span>{{.Assignee.Login}}</span>
<img src="{{.Assignee.AvatarURL}}" alt="{{.Assignee.Login}}" class="avatar" title="Assigned to {{.Assignee.Login}}">
{{end}}
</div>
</div>
+6 -2
View File
@@ -510,13 +510,17 @@ a:active {
max-width: 960px;
}
.card-grid {
.card-grid,
#issue-list,
#pull-list {
display: grid;
grid-template-columns: repeat(2, 1fr);
gap: var(--spacing-sm);
}
.card-grid .card {
.card-grid .card,
#issue-list .card,
#pull-list .card {
margin-bottom: 0;
}
}